We’re looking for a talented and driven Design Engineer to join our Design Team. This is an exciting opportunity to play a key role in delivering high-quality, innovative drainage solutions for a wide range of construction projects. In this role, you’ll combine technical expertise with customer insight—translating project requirements into practical, commercially viable designs that support both our customers and business growth. If you are looking for a Design Engineering role in Bedfordshire, then this could be for you!

Location: Bedford (with move to Shefford within 24 months)
Full-time: 34.5 hours per week, Monday–Friday

What You’ll Be Doing:

  • Designing and developing drainage solutions using SolidWorks (sheet metal) and other design tools
  • Producing accurate 3D models, layouts, and technical drawings
  • Interpreting customer requirements, specifications, and construction drawings
  • Creating detailed technical proposals and specifications
  • Providing expert advice on product applications and system performance
  • Supporting costing and estimating with commercially viable designs
  • Managing multiple design enquiries to deliver on time and to a high standard
  • Collaborating with sales, manufacturing, and technical teams to ensure smooth project delivery
  • Building strong relationships with customers, consultants, and contractors

What We’re Looking For:

  • Strong experience in a Design Engineering role (ideally within construction, drainage, or similar sectors)
  • Proficiency in SolidWorks (especially sheet metal design) and experience using AutoCAD
  • Ability to interpret technical drawings and specifications
  • High attention to detail and commitment to design accuracy
  • Excellent organisation and time‑management skills
  • Strong communication skills and a customer‑focused mindset
